/* Signed arithmetic shift right. */
static inline word
SASR_W (word x, word by)
{	return (x >> by) ;
} /* SASR */

static inline longword
SASR_L (longword x, word by)
{	return (x >> by) ;
} /* SASR */

/*
 *	Prototypes from add.c
 */
word	gsm_mult 		(word a, word b) ;
longword gsm_L_mult 	(word a, word b) ;
word	gsm_mult_r		(word a, word b) ;

word	gsm_div  		(word num, word denum) ;

word	gsm_add 		(word a, word b ) ;
longword gsm_L_add 	(longword a, longword b ) ;

word	gsm_sub 		(word a, word b) ;
longword gsm_L_sub 	(longword a, longword b) ;

word	gsm_abs 		(word a) ;

word	gsm_norm 		(longword a ) ;

longword gsm_L_asl  	(longword a, int n) ;
word	gsm_asl 		(word a, int n) ;

longword gsm_L_asr  	(longword a, int n) ;
word	gsm_asr  		(word a, int n) ;

/*
 *  Inlined functions from add.h
 */

static inline longword
GSM_MULT_R (word a, word b)
{	return (((longword) (a)) * ((longword) (b)) + 16384) >> 15 ;
} /* GSM_MULT_R */

static inline longword
GSM_MULT (word a, word b)
{	return (((longword) (a)) * ((longword) (b))) >> 15 ;
} /* GSM_MULT */

static inline longword
GSM_L_MULT (word a, word b)
{	return ((longword) (a)) * ((longword) (b)) << 1 ;
} /* GSM_L_MULT */

static inline longword
GSM_L_ADD (longword a, longword b)
{	ulongword utmp ;

	if (a < 0 && b < 0)
	{	utmp = (ulongword)-((a) + 1) + (ulongword)-((b) + 1) ;
		return (utmp >= (ulongword) MAX_LONGWORD) ? MIN_LONGWORD : -(longword)utmp-2 ;
		} ;

	if (a > 0 && b > 0)
	{	utmp = (ulongword) a + (ulongword) b ;
		return (utmp >= (ulongword) MAX_LONGWORD) ? MAX_LONGWORD : utmp ;
		} ;

	return a + b ;
} /* GSM_L_ADD */

static inline longword
GSM_ADD (word a, word b)
{	longword ltmp ;

	ltmp = ((longword) a) + ((longword) b) ;

	if (ltmp >= MAX_WORD)
		return MAX_WORD ;
	if (ltmp <= MIN_WORD)
		return MIN_WORD ;

	return ltmp ;
} /* GSM_ADD */

static inline longword
GSM_SUB (word a, word b)
{	longword ltmp ;

	ltmp = ((longword) a) - ((longword) b) ;

	if (ltmp >= MAX_WORD)
		ltmp = MAX_WORD ;
	else if (ltmp <= MIN_WORD)
		ltmp = MIN_WORD ;

	return ltmp ;
} /* GSM_SUB */

static inline word
GSM_ABS (word a)
{
	if (a > 0)
		return a ;
	if (a == MIN_WORD)
		return MAX_WORD ;
	return -a ;
} /* GSM_ADD */
